Q: Is 423,214,299 a Prime Number?
A: No, 423,214,299 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 423214299 can be evenly divided by 1 3 9 43 129 387 1,093,577 3,280,731 9,842,193 47,023,811 141,071,433 and 423,214,299, with no remainder.
Since 423,214,299 cannot be divided by just 1 and 423,214,299, it is not a prime number.
